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Bank Vole | Kuhl's Lorikeet |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Psittaciformes (Parrots) |
| Family | Cricetidae | Psittacidae (True Parrots) |
| Genus | Myodes | Vini |
| Species | Myodes glareolus | Vini kuhlii |
Evolutionary Relationship
Bank Vole and Kuhl's Lorikeet share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
